Responsibilities

  • Provide customer service to patients, visitors, and/or staff by carrying out security-related procedures, site-specific policies, and when appropriate, emergency response activities in a healthcare location.
  • Respond to incidents, disturbances, and/or critical situations in a calm, problem-solving manner, documenting observations and reporting concerns to site leadership according to post instructions.
  • Conduct regular and random patrols throughout buildings, parking areas, and perimeter locations to help to deter unauthorized activity and identify unusual conditions.
  • Monitor access points and visitor activity, assist with directions and general assistance, and communicate with staff regarding security-related concerns and/or policy questions.
  • Support emergency and medical-related response efforts by helping with crowd management, access control, and coordination with first responders and/or designated personnel.
